Pulmonary embolism (PE) and deep vein thrombosis (DVT) are widely regarded as manifestations of a single disease, venous thromboembolism (VTE). An evidence-based approach to the treatment of acute VTE will be reviewed here. Currently available therapeutic options will be emphasized; possible future treatment approaches will be discussed briefly. The chronic management of VTE involves assessment of the risks and benefits of prolonged anticoagulation and is discussed in more detail elsewhere in this issue. |
